Frequently Asked Questions about Carmel
How much are Studio apartments in Carmel?
There are currently 38 Studio Apartments in Carmel with rent ranges from $695 to $4,883 with an average price of $1,113.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Carmel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Carmel ranges from $800 to $3,718 with an average monthly rent of $1,440.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Carmel c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Carmel range from $1,009 to $4,146.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,789.
How expensive are Carmel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 77 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Carmel on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,159 to $6,754 - averaging $2,325 for the location.
